What Is a bid Bond and Why Is It Vital?



a bid bond acts as an economic safeguard in the construction bidding procedure. It guarantees that you'll honor your bid if granted the project.

Essentially, it protects the job owner from possible losses if you back out after winning the agreement. By giving a bid bond, you show your dedication and dependability, which can improve your track record among clients.

It likewise assists you stand apart from competitors who may not use this assurance. Without a bid bond, you run the risk of shedding chances, as many tasks need it as part of the bidding procedure.

Recognizing the significance of bid bonds can assist you safeguard contracts and construct trust fund with clients while guaranteeing you're economically safeguarded throughout the bidding process.

Exactly How bid Bonds Work: The Process Explained



When you make a decision to position a bid on a construction project, comprehending just how bid bonds work is critical for your success.

First, you'll need to acquire a bid bond from a surety company, which acts as a warranty that you'll meet your responsibilities if granted the contract. You'll generally pay a premium based on the complete bid quantity.

When you submit your bid, the bond ensures the task proprietor that if you fail to honor your bid, the surety will certainly cover the expenses, up to the bond's limitation.

If you win the contract, the bid bond is commonly changed by a performance bond. This process helps secure the rate of interests of all events involved and makes certain that you're serious about your proposal.
